How Do You Design Kitchen Appliances?

Designing kitchen appliances can be a tricky task, since there is so much to consider. With the right design, kitchen appliances can look great and function well.

The first step in designing kitchen appliances is to assess the space available in the kitchen. This includes measuring the size of the room, taking into account any obstacles such as doorways or existing furniture, and determining how much counter space is available. Once this is done, you can begin to select which type of appliance you would like to buy.

The most important factor when choosing a kitchen appliance is functionality. Consider the needs of your family and what type of use each appliance will receive.

For example, if you have a large family that cooks often, it may be worth investing in a larger refrigerator or stove with more features than you would need for a smaller family or someone who does not cook as often. This will ensure that your appliances are able to handle the load that they will be subjected to on a regular basis.

When selecting an appliance design, it’s important to consider how it will fit into the overall aesthetic of your kitchen. If you are looking for an industrial look, stainless steel appliances may be best for your space.

Alternatively, if you prefer something more traditional or contemporary, wooden cabinetry and white finishes can create a softer look in your kitchen. It’s also important to note that certain colors may clash with other elements in your kitchen such as countertops and flooring; therefore it is important to take these elements into consideration when selecting your appliance colors.

Finally, when designing kitchen appliances it’s essential to select models that are energy efficient and durable enough to withstand continuous usage over time. Energy efficiency ratings can help determine which models are best suited for your needs while also helping you save money on electricity bills over time.
